    is it coming from the engine? Usually anything in the rotating assembly making noise will make it much much faster than that. It could be coming from the water pump or even the power steering pump. The bearings sometimeswear out. Try grabbing the water pump pulley and pulling on it, it shouldnt really have any play. Do the same with the other pulleys.
